Uploaded image for project: 'Gump'
  1. Gump
  2. GUMP-50

A portable/robust lock is needed (that the OS cleans up)

    XMLWordPrintableJSON

Details

    • Bug
    • Status: Closed
    • Major
    • Resolution: Fixed
    • Gump2-2.4
    • Gump3-alpha-3
    • Python-based Gump
    • None

    Description

      A lock is required so two gump processes do not run at the same time, and conflict. The mechanism employed today is flawed in that the OS can not clean up the lock on process termination, so we get stray locks left around.

      P.S. Eventually we ought lock the workspace, and ensure that two workspaces can run simultaneously. Right now even that is not true, with use fo $GUMP/tmp.

      Attachments

        Activity

          People

            Unassigned Unassigned
            ajack Adam R. B. Jack
            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: